Comprehending the Need for Parrot Adoption
Parrots, especially those that are more common family pet types, typically find themselves in shelters for different reasons, consisting of:
Owner Surrender: Many individuals underestimate the commitment needed to look after a parrot. Kinds Of Parrots Commonly Found in Shelters
Although numerous types of parrots may be offered for adoption, the following list highlights the ones most commonly found in shelters:

Contrary to common belief, embracing a parrot from a shelter is workable and straightforward. Here's a short summary of the steps included:
Visit a Shelter: Research regional shelters or parrot rescue organizations and arrange a check out to satisfy the birds.Total an Application: Fill out an adoption application to reveal your intentions and provide your background.Interview: Most shelters carry out interviews to examine your readiness and match you with a proper bird.Home Visit: Some shelters might need a home visit to ensure your living conditions appropriate for a parrot.Adoption Fee: Upon approval, you'll normally need to pay an adoption charge, which might differ by organization.Post-Adoption Support: Many shelters use post-adoption resources to help you transition into parrot ownership.Frequently asked questions

Q: What supplies do I need for a parrot?A: You will need an ideal cage, food and water meals, sets down, toys for psychological stimulation, and a quality diet.

Q: Do parrots require socialization?A: Yes, parrots are highly social animals and require day-to-day interaction with their owners for their psychological health. Q: Are there any behavioral issues I must be mindful of?A: Some parrots may display behavioral problems due to past experiences, but with time, patience, and training, lots of can adjust positively. Q: What if I dislike birds?A: If you have allergies, it's best to seek advice from a medical expert before embracing a parrot, as they can produce dander.
